* Re: [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
@ 2025-09-15 23:59 ` Ilya Mashkin
2025-09-16 6:52 ` Alexey V. Vissarionov
2025-09-16 11:00 ` Gleb Fotengauer-Malinovskiy
0 siblings, 2 replies; 7+ messages in thread
From: Ilya Mashkin @ 2025-09-15 23:59 UTC (permalink / raw)
To: ALT Devel discussion list
Всем привет!
Я что-то пропустил?
Поиск по "srpm.signed" нигде никаких ответов не выдал.
On Tue, Sep 16, 2025 at 2:51 AM Girar awaiter (oddity)
<girar-builder@altlinux.org> wrote:
>
> https://git.altlinux.org/tasks/395008/logs/events.1.1.log
> https://packages.altlinux.org/tasks/395008
>
> subtask name aarch64 i586 x86_64
> #100 asio 2:04 1:20 1:14
>
> 2025-Sep-15 23:49:04 :: test-only task #395008 for sisyphus started by oddity:
> #100 build asio-1.36.0-alt1.src.rpm
> 2025-Sep-15 23:49:05 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build start
> 2025-Sep-15 23:49:05 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build start
> 2025-Sep-15 23:49:05 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build start
> 2025-Sep-15 23:50:19 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build OK
> 2025-Sep-15 23:50:25 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build OK
> 2025-Sep-15 23:51:09 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build OK
> cat: build/100/x86_64/srpm.signed: No such file or directory
> 2025-Sep-15 23:51:09 :: task #395008 for sisyphus FAILED
^ permalink raw reply [flat|nested] 7+ messages in thread
* Re: [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-15 23:59 ` [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m Ilya Mashkin
@ 2025-09-16 6:52 ` Alexey V. Vissarionov
2025-09-16 7:16 ` Ivan A. Melnikov
2025-09-16 11:00 ` Gleb Fotengauer-Malinovskiy
1 sibling, 1 reply; 7+ messages in thread
From: Alexey V. Vissarionov @ 2025-09-16 6:52 UTC (permalink / raw)
To: ALT Linux Team development discussions
Good ${greeting_time}!
On 2025-09-16 02:59:16 +0300, Ilya Mashkin wrote:
> Я что-то пропустил?
> Поиск по "srpm.signed" нигде никаких ответов не выдал.
>> cat: build/100/x86_64/srpm.signed: No such file or directory
% apf f srpm.signed | wc -l
0
Кто-то опять отлаживается на Сизифе...
--
Alexey V. Vissarionov
gremlin ПРИ altlinux ТЧК org; +vii-cmiii-ccxxix-lxxix-xlii
GPG: 0D92F19E1C0DC36E27F61A29CD17E2B43D879005 @ hkp://keys.gnupg.net
^ permalink raw reply [flat|nested] 7+ messages in thread
* Re: [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-16 6:52 ` Alexey V. Vissarionov
@ 2025-09-16 7:16 ` Ivan A. Melnikov
2025-09-16 7:42 ` Anton Farygin
0 siblings, 1 reply; 7+ messages in thread
From: Ivan A. Melnikov @ 2025-09-16 7:16 UTC (permalink / raw)
To: ALT Linux Team development discussions
On Tue, Sep 16, 2025 at 09:52:00AM +0300, Alexey V. Vissarionov wrote:
> Good ${greeting_time}!
>
> On 2025-09-16 02:59:16 +0300, Ilya Mashkin wrote:
>
> > Я что-то пропустил?
> > Поиск по "srpm.signed" нигде никаких ответов не выдал.
> >> cat: build/100/x86_64/srpm.signed: No such file or directory
>
> % apf f srpm.signed | wc -l
> 0
>
> Кто-то опять отлаживается на Сизифе...
Скорее, в продакшене girar.
Этот файл создаётся при сборке из gear, но не из src.rpm, примерно тут:
https://git.altlinux.org/people/ldv/packages/girar.git?a=blob;f=gb/gb-task-build-arch-i;h=65eca5223999b1310c7ebb958bc7d6dc633780e8#l151
Видимо, кто-то опять забыл про src.rpm.
К сожалению, пушить изменения в публично доступые места не в традициях
мейнтейнеров gyle.altlinux.org, так что мы не знаем, что это такое,
и просто ждём традиционного "попробуйте ещё раз".
--
wbr,
iv m.
^ permalink raw reply [flat|nested] 7+ messages in thread
* Re: [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-16 7:16 ` Ivan A. Melnikov
@ 2025-09-16 7:42 ` Anton Farygin
0 siblings, 0 replies; 7+ messages in thread
From: Anton Farygin @ 2025-09-16 7:42 UTC (permalink / raw)
To: devel
On 9/16/25 10:16, Ivan A. Melnikov wrote:
> On Tue, Sep 16, 2025 at 09:52:00AM +0300, Alexey V. Vissarionov wrote:
>> Good ${greeting_time}!
>>
>> On 2025-09-16 02:59:16 +0300, Ilya Mashkin wrote:
>>
>> > Я что-то пропустил?
>> > Поиск по "srpm.signed" нигде никаких ответов не выдал.
>> >> cat: build/100/x86_64/srpm.signed: No such file or directory
>>
>> % apf f srpm.signed | wc -l
>> 0
>>
>> Кто-то опять отлаживается на Сизифе...
> Скорее, в продакшене girar.
>
> Этот файл создаётся при сборке из gear, но не из src.rpm, примерно тут:
>
> https://git.altlinux.org/people/ldv/packages/girar.git?a=blob;f=gb/gb-task-build-arch-i;h=65eca5223999b1310c7ebb958bc7d6dc633780e8#l151
>
> Видимо, кто-то опять забыл про src.rpm.
>
> К сожалению, пушить изменения в публично доступые места не в традициях
> мейнтейнеров gyle.altlinux.org, так что мы не знаем, что это такое,
> и просто ждём традиционного "попробуйте ещё раз".
>
https://altlinux.space/ALTLinux/girar
Тут тоже без движения.
^ permalink raw reply [flat|nested] 7+ messages in thread
* Re: [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-15 23:59 ` [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m Ilya Mashkin
2025-09-16 6:52 ` Alexey V. Vissarionov
@ 2025-09-16 11:00 ` Gleb Fotengauer-Malinovskiy
2025-09-16 11:55 ` [devel] [girar] build check cache // was: " Ivan A. Melnikov
1 sibling, 1 reply; 7+ messages in thread
From: Gleb Fotengauer-Malinovskiy @ 2025-09-16 11:00 UTC (permalink / raw)
To: ALT Linux Team development discussions
[-- Attachment #1: Type: text/plain, Size: 1584 bytes --]
Hi,
On Tue, Sep 16, 2025 at 02:59:16AM +0300, Ilya Mashkin wrote:
> Всем привет!
>
> On Tue, Sep 16, 2025 at 2:51 AM Girar awaiter (oddity)
> <girar-builder@altlinux.org> wrote:
> >
> > https://git.altlinux.org/tasks/395008/logs/events.1.1.log
> > https://packages.altlinux.org/tasks/395008
> >
> > subtask name aarch64 i586 x86_64
> > #100 asio 2:04 1:20 1:14
> >
> > 2025-Sep-15 23:49:04 :: test-only task #395008 for sisyphus started by oddity:
> > #100 build asio-1.36.0-alt1.src.rpm
> > 2025-Sep-15 23:49:05 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build start
> > 2025-Sep-15 23:49:05 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build start
> > 2025-Sep-15 23:49:05 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build start
> > 2025-Sep-15 23:50:19 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> 2025-Sep-15 23:50:25 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build OK
> > 2025-Sep-15 23:51:09 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> cat: build/100/x86_64/srpm.signed: No such file or directory
> > 2025-Sep-15 23:51:09 :: task #395008 for sisyphus FAILED
>
> Я что-то пропустил?
>
> Поиск по "srpm.signed" нигде никаких ответов не выдал.
К сожалению, внесённая вчера новая фича не была достаточно продумана и
протестирована.
Сейчас должно работать, приношу извинения за доставленные неудобства.
--
glebfm
[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 801 bytes --]
^ permalink raw reply [flat|nested] 7+ messages in thread
* [devel] [girar] build check cache // was: Re: [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-16 11:00 ` Gleb Fotengauer-Malinovskiy
@ 2025-09-16 11:55 ` Ivan A. Melnikov
2025-09-17 14:52 ` Gleb Fotengauer-Malinovskiy
0 siblings, 1 reply; 7+ messages in thread
From: Ivan A. Melnikov @ 2025-09-16 11:55 UTC (permalink / raw)
To: ALT Linux Team development discussions
On Tue, Sep 16, 2025 at 02:00:01PM +0300, Gleb Fotengauer-Malinovskiy wrote:
> Hi,
>
> On Tue, Sep 16, 2025 at 02:59:16AM +0300, Ilya Mashkin wrote:
> > Всем привет!
> >
> > On Tue, Sep 16, 2025 at 2:51 AM Girar awaiter (oddity)
> > <girar-builder@altlinux.org> wrote:
> > >
> > > https://git.altlinux.org/tasks/395008/logs/events.1.1.log
> > > https://packages.altlinux.org/tasks/395008
> > >
> > > subtask name aarch64 i586 x86_64
> > > #100 asio 2:04 1:20 1:14
> > >
> > > 2025-Sep-15 23:49:04 :: test-only task #395008 for sisyphus started by oddity:
> > > #100 build asio-1.36.0-alt1.src.rpm
> > > 2025-Sep-15 23:49:05 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build start
> > > 2025-Sep-15 23:49:05 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build start
> > > 2025-Sep-15 23:49:05 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build start
> > > 2025-Sep-15 23:50:19 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> 2025-Sep-15 23:50:25 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> 2025-Sep-15 23:51:09 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> cat: build/100/x86_64/srpm.signed: No such file or directory
> > > 2025-Sep-15 23:51:09 :: task #395008 for sisyphus FAILED
> >
> > Я что-то пропустил?
> >
> > Поиск по "srpm.signed" нигде никаких ответов не выдал.
>
> К сожалению, внесённая вчера новая фича не была достаточно продумана и
> протестирована.
> Сейчас должно работать, приношу извинения за доставленные неудобства.
Кеширование build check'ов это огнище, спасибо Глеб!
Однако посмотрев код я не очень понял, как инвалидируется кеш при
обновлении репозитория. Например, такая история:
1. в test-only задаче собирается пакет foo-1-alt1 (TESTED);
2. в другой задаче собирается foo-1-alt2;
3. задача из п.1 запускается с --commit.
Если пакет foo собирается из git, то только проверки в
gb-task-check-build-i помешают закоммитить задачу с уменьшением
EVR пакета foo; однако если они уже в кеше как успешные,
они ничему не помешают.
--
wbr,
iv m.
^ permalink raw reply [flat|nested] 7+ messages in thread
* Re: [devel] [girar] build check cache // was: Re: [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m
2025-09-16 11:55 ` [devel] [girar] build check cache // was: " Ivan A. Melnikov
@ 2025-09-17 14:52 ` Gleb Fotengauer-Malinovskiy
0 siblings, 0 replies; 7+ messages in thread
From: Gleb Fotengauer-Malinovskiy @ 2025-09-17 14:52 UTC (permalink / raw)
To: ALT Linux Team development discussions
[-- Attachment #1: Type: text/plain, Size: 3150 bytes --]
On Tue, Sep 16, 2025 at 03:55:16PM +0400, Ivan A. Melnikov wrote:
> On Tue, Sep 16, 2025 at 02:00:01PM +0300, Gleb Fotengauer-Malinovskiy wrote:
> > Hi,
> >
> > On Tue, Sep 16, 2025 at 02:59:16AM +0300, Ilya Mashkin wrote:
> > > Всем привет!
> > >
> > > On Tue, Sep 16, 2025 at 2:51 AM Girar awaiter (oddity)
> > > <girar-builder@altlinux.org> wrote:
> > > >
> > > > https://git.altlinux.org/tasks/395008/logs/events.1.1.log
> > > > https://packages.altlinux.org/tasks/395008
> > > >
> > > > subtask name aarch64 i586 x86_64
> > > > #100 asio 2:04 1:20 1:14
> > > >
> > > > 2025-Sep-15 23:49:04 :: test-only task #395008 for sisyphus started by oddity:
> > > > #100 build asio-1.36.0-alt1.src.rpm
> > > > 2025-Sep-15 23:49:05 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build start
> > > > 2025-Sep-15 23:49:05 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build start
> > > > 2025-Sep-15 23:49:05 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build start
> > > > 2025-Sep-15 23:50:19 :: [x86_64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> > 2025-Sep-15 23:50:25 :: [i586]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> > 2025-Sep-15 23:51:09 :: [aarch64] #100 asio-1.36.0-alt1.src.rpm: build OK
> > > > cat: build/100/x86_64/srpm.signed: No such file or directory
> > > > 2025-Sep-15 23:51:09 :: task #395008 for sisyphus FAILED
> > >
> > > Я что-то пропустил?
> > >
> > > Поиск по "srpm.signed" нигде никаких ответов не выдал.
> >
> > К сожалению, внесённая вчера новая фича не была достаточно продумана и
> > протестирована.
> > Сейчас должно работать, приношу извинения за доставленные неудобства.
>
> Кеширование build check'ов это огнище, спасибо Глеб!
>
> Однако посмотрев код я не очень понял, как инвалидируется кеш при
> обновлении репозитория. Например, такая история:
>
> 1. в test-only задаче собирается пакет foo-1-alt1 (TESTED);
> 2. в другой задаче собирается foo-1-alt2;
> 3. задача из п.1 запускается с --commit.
>
> Если пакет foo собирается из git, то только проверки в
> gb-task-check-build-i помешают закоммитить задачу с уменьшением
> EVR пакета foo; однако если они уже в кеше как успешные,
> они ничему не помешают.
Спасибо, я действительно поторопился, откатил пока совсем. Там ворох
сильно разных проверок собранных под одним заголовком. Нужно внимательно
делить на кешируемое и некешируемое и часть ещё явно можно
соптимизировать.
--
glebfm
[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 801 bytes --]
^ permalink raw reply [flat|nested] 7+ messages in thread
end of thread, other threads:[~2025-09-17 14:52 UTC | newest]
Thread overview: 7+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2025-09-15 23:59 ` [devel] [#395008] [test-only] FAILED srpm=asio-1.36.0-alt1.src.rpm Ilya Mashkin
2025-09-16 6:52 ` Alexey V. Vissarionov
2025-09-16 7:16 ` Ivan A. Melnikov
2025-09-16 7:42 ` Anton Farygin
2025-09-16 11:00 ` Gleb Fotengauer-Malinovskiy
2025-09-16 11:55 ` [devel] [girar] build check cache // was: " Ivan A. Melnikov
2025-09-17 14:52 ` Gleb Fotengauer-Malinovskiy
ALT Linux Team development discussions
This inbox may be cloned and mirrored by anyone:
git clone --mirror http://lore.altlinux.org/devel/0 devel/git/0.git
# If you have public-inbox 1.1+ installed, you may
# initialize and index your mirror using the following commands:
public-inbox-init -V2 devel devel/ http://lore.altlinux.org/devel \
devel@altlinux.org devel@altlinux.ru devel@lists.altlinux.org devel@lists.altlinux.ru devel@linux.iplabs.ru mandrake-russian@linuxteam.iplabs.ru sisyphus@linuxteam.iplabs.ru
public-inbox-index devel
Example config snippet for mirrors.
Newsgroup available over NNTP:
nntp://lore.altlinux.org/org.altlinux.lists.devel
AGPL code for this site: git clone https://public-inbox.org/public-inbox.git